easy
//ˈiːzi//
Adjective
easyCanonical form
easierComparative
easiestSuperlative
1
Not difficult; requiring little effort or skill to accomplish or understand.
This test is easy.
2
Free from worry, anxiety, or pain; comfortable and relaxed.
She felt easy in her mind after hearing the good news.
3
Not strict or demanding; lenient or tolerant.
My teacher is easy on students who make mistakes.

Adverb
easyCanonical form
easierComparative
easiestSuperlative
1
In a relaxed or gentle manner; without hurry or force.
Take it easy and don't rush.
